Output dde7523b7e2fd3f985ad8e427069dd38dcedd080a3ec1e48a1b0d60ad7175887:1

value
38396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f65cb4083f04aba7f574adf068568156bde8a029 OP_EQUAL
address
3Q9fCsLysLySndJ5hsRhiSiD228xxYcpYW
transaction
dde7523b7e2fd3f985ad8e427069dd38dcedd080a3ec1e48a1b0d60ad7175887
confirmations
168325
spent
true